Understanding ISF and Its Importance

The Importer Security Filing, commonly referred to as ISF, is a mandatory requirement established by U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P). It is designed to enhance the security of international trade by collecting data before goods arrive at U.S. ports. Understanding this paperwork is essential for anyone importing eyebrow stencils or any other items into the United States.

The ISF filing is due at least 24 hours before your cargo is loaded onto a ship destined for the U.S. This means you need to prepare well in advance to ensure compliance and avoid penalties. ISF penalties can range from $500 to $5,000 per violation, which can become quite costly if you’re not careful.

Why You Might Face ISF Penalties

Before you can effectively avoid ISF penalties, it’s important to understand why they might occur in the first place. There are several common reasons that could lead to penalties associated with importing eyebrow stencils.

Missing or Incomplete Filings

One of the most frequent reasons for penalties is missing or incomplete ISF filings. If you fail to submit your ISF or don’t provide all the required information, you risk facing fines.

Incorrect Data Submission

Providing incorrect data on your ISF filing can also lead to penalties. This could mean inaccurate shipping details or misclassified goods, which can confuse customs officials and lengthen the clearance process.

Late Filings

Submitting your ISF after the deadline, which is 24 hours before loading, will definitely lead to a penalty. It’s important to establish a timeline and stick to it.

Failure to Update Changes

If there are any changes after you file your ISF, such as corrections to the shipping information, it’s crucial to update CBP promptly. Failure to do so may result in penalties.

Lack of Knowledge

Sometimes simply not knowing the requirements or the process can lead to penalties. Familiarizing yourself with the specifics will help you avoid these issues.

Tips for Avoiding ISF Penalties

Now that you have a clearer picture of what ISF penalties are and why they occur, let’s discuss how you can avoid them when importing eyebrow stencils.

1. Know What Information Is Required

Understanding what information you need to provide in your ISF is your first line of defense against penalties. Here’s a breakdown of the key data points that you need to submit:

ISF Data Requirement Details
Importer of Record The person or company responsible for the shipment
Supplier The entity from whom you purchased the goods
Manufacturer The party who produced the eyebrow stencils
Country of Origin Where the eyebrow stencils were made
Description of Goods Clear and concise description of eyebrow stencils
Quantity Total number of units being imported
Port of Loading The port where the goods will be loaded onto the ship
Consignee The individual or company that will receive the goods

Customs Bonds

A customs bond is often required when importing goods into the U.S. It serves as a contract between you and the government, protecting them from any unpaid duties or penalties. If you’re importing eyebrow stencils frequently, it’s worth investing in a bond to streamline future transactions.

Understand the Customs Broker’s Role

If you’re not comfortable managing ISF filings, consider employing a licensed customs broker. They are experts in navigating customs regulations, and they can help ensure your filings comply with all requirements.
